Venom Computers: This is how the PC should be done

With design and product director Jaan Turon

What games devices and PC brands do you specialise in?

Venom first started making performance computers specifically for engineers and architects. These applications rely heavily on speed and reliability. This combination obviously appeals to serious gamers, although our customers are still mostly professionals and business users. We also make high-performance notebook computers.

When did your company first get involved in this area?

Venom has been making desktop computers since the late 2000s. In 2012, we made our first Venom BlackBook notebook, which has been a multi-award-winning success.

What credentials and certifications does your business have?

We are an Intel global partner, as well as a Microsoft OEM partner. Through our global value chain, we have various offices and partners throughout the US west coast, Taiwan, China, Hong Kong, Singapore, Korea, Turkey, Scandinavia and, of course, Australia.

Which distributors do you use?

Our distributor is fellow Australian company Dicker Data. We reach our customers via our trusted partners – Venom computers are only available through authorised Venom resellers.

What are the most interesting new developments in performance PCs?

The recent rhetoric about how the “PC is dead” has given Venom a huge opportunity to show the big players how the PC should be done: with great, highly functional designs. Next up is our slimline semi-rugged 2-in-1 laptop with embedded retractable handle, followed by our take on the detachable 2-in-1 business device.

Can you tell us about a recent deployment?

We recently partnered with a major architectural firm in setting up its design studio. In another notable deployment, we supplied Ultrabooks to executives at a defence contractor.
